The orange dinosaur was featured on the first GAS Geocoin, the orange dinosaur was taken from the GeocachingAlbertaSouth.com website banner. The second GAS Geocoin also features a dinosaur on one face, in this case it is a purple dinosaur, not just any purple dinosaur though, the second GAS Geocoin features a purple Albertosaurus. The Albertosaurus was named in honour of the province of Alberta where it was discovered.

One side of the geocoin features a buffalo/eagle-feather headdress, this type of medicine hat has been symbolic of our community, Medicine Hat, for over 100 years.

This geocoin will only be available from The Geocoin Store and it is being produced using the same model as the first GAS Geocoin so there will not be any of these coins available for trade nor will any be available for sale afterwards, this coin will not be remade.

All of the sale profits will be realized as geocoins and all of these geocoins will be given away as new unactivated geocoins in geocaches. When you buy this geocoin you are helping to put new unactivated geocoins in caches which creates enduring excitement for those who find them.

There are unique features on this geocoin and the description of the geocoin that was submitted to The Geocoin Store offers a good explanation for the choices made on the coin including the rich palette of prairie colours.

The Alberta artist, peanutbutterbreadandjam, who created the design for this geocoin also created the design for the 2006 Alberta Wild Rose.
